Hallo liebe Forenmitglieder,
ich habe eine Datenstruktur die einer File entspricht also:
Code:
DSUPPRSP E DS EXTNAME(UPPRSP) INZ
Leider brauche ich in einem SQL zusätzlich noch die RRN also
Code:
Select upprps.*, rrn(upprsp) from upprps where...
Jetzt war mein erster gedanke dass ich einfach eine Datenstruktur erstelle die wiederum eine Datenstruktur enthält also:
Code:
SQLDSUPPRSP DS Qualified
XUPPRSP LIKEDS(DSUPPRSP)
RRNO LIKE(X_PXORRN)
Das Ergebnis ist leider dass der SQL-Compiler :
Code:
SQL0312 30 920 Position 37 Variable SQLDSUPPRSP nicht definiert oder
nicht verwendbar.
919 C/EXEC SQL
920 C+ FETCH NEXT FROM CSR01 INTO :SQLDSUPPRSP
921 C/END-EXEC
Wenn ich jedoch wieder den Fetch auf DSUPPRSP erstelle gehts, mir fehlt jedoch die RRN.
Jetzt jedes einzelne Feld in den Fetch zu quetschen ist mir persönlich zu doof, da ja auch Änderungen an der Datei jedesmal ein Geraffel werden.
Release V6.1
Viele Grüße
Bookmarks